图形化编程可以做什么主题
-
图形化编程是一种通过拖拽和连接图形化元素来编写代码的方法。它可以帮助初学者和非专业人士更轻松地学习和理解编程概念,同时也能够加快开发速度和提高代码的可读性。那么,图形化编程可以用来做什么呢?
首先,图形化编程可以用来创建游戏。通过使用图形化编程工具,开发者可以轻松地创建游戏场景、角色、动画效果等。无需编写繁琐的代码,只需简单地拖拽和连接图形化元素,就可以实现游戏的逻辑和功能。这使得非专业人士也能够参与游戏开发,并且可以加快游戏的开发速度。
其次,图形化编程可以用来制作交互式应用程序。无论是移动应用程序、桌面应用程序还是Web应用程序,图形化编程都可以帮助开发者快速创建用户界面和实现交互功能。通过拖拽和连接图形化元素,开发者可以轻松地添加按钮、文本框、图像等组件,并定义它们的行为和交互逻辑。这使得非专业人士也能够参与应用程序开发,并且可以快速迭代和调试。
另外,图形化编程还可以用来制作数据可视化图表。通过使用图形化编程工具,开发者可以将数据转化为可视化图表,如折线图、柱状图、饼图等。通过拖拽和连接图形化元素,开发者可以轻松地定义数据源、图表类型、样式等,并实时预览和调整图表效果。这使得非专业人士也能够参与数据可视化的制作,并且可以更直观地理解和分析数据。
此外,图形化编程还可以用来控制硬件设备。通过使用图形化编程工具,开发者可以轻松地与各种硬件设备进行交互,如Arduino、树莓派等。通过拖拽和连接图形化元素,开发者可以定义传感器的输入、执行器的输出等,并实时监测和控制设备的状态。这使得非专业人士也能够参与物联网的开发,并且可以更方便地搭建各种智能硬件系统。
总之,图形化编程可以用来做游戏开发、应用程序开发、数据可视化以及物联网开发等。它的优势在于简化了编程过程,使得非专业人士也能够参与开发,并且可以加快开发速度和提高代码的可读性。因此,图形化编程在教育、创意、科研等领域有着广泛的应用前景。
1年前 -
图形化编程是一种通过图形界面来创建程序的编程方式。它使得编程变得更加直观和可视化,不需要繁琐的代码编写,适合初学者和非专业人士。图形化编程可以应用于许多不同的主题和领域,下面是其中五个主题:
-
游戏开发:图形化编程可以用于游戏开发,让用户能够通过拖拽和连接图形化模块来创建游戏逻辑,设计游戏场景和角色等。例如,Scratch是一款流行的图形化编程工具,可以用于创建各种类型的游戏,从简单的平台游戏到复杂的角色扮演游戏。
-
机器人编程:图形化编程可以用于控制和编程各种类型的机器人,如机器人小车、无人机、机械臂等。通过图形化界面,用户可以轻松地编写机器人的行为和动作,实现自动化任务和交互式控制。
-
物联网应用:图形化编程可以用于开发物联网应用,将各种智能设备连接起来,并进行数据传输和交互。用户可以使用图形化界面来配置设备之间的连接和交互规则,实现智能家居、智能城市和工业物联网等应用。
-
数据可视化:图形化编程可以用于创建各种类型的数据可视化图表和图形。用户可以通过拖拽和连接图形化模块来处理和展示数据,例如创建柱状图、折线图、饼图等。这对于数据分析和决策支持非常有帮助。
-
艺术创作:图形化编程可以用于艺术创作,让用户能够通过图形界面来创作和设计各种艺术作品。例如,Processing是一款流行的图形化编程工具,可以用于创作各种艺术图形、交互装置和动态影像等。
总之,图形化编程可以应用于许多不同的主题,从游戏开发到机器人编程,从物联网应用到数据可视化,从艺术创作到教育培训等。它为非专业人士和初学者提供了一种更加直观和易于理解的编程方式。
1年前 -
-
图形化编程是一种通过可视化方式编写代码的方法,它可以用于各种主题和领域。以下是一些常见的图形化编程主题:
-
游戏开发:图形化编程工具可以帮助开发人员创建各种类型的游戏,包括2D和3D游戏。用户可以使用拖放功能来设计游戏场景、角色和动画,以及添加交互性和游戏逻辑。
-
机器人编程:图形化编程工具可以用于编写机器人的控制程序。用户可以使用图形化界面来设计机器人的行为和动作序列,例如行走、转向、抓取物体等。这种方法使机器人编程更加直观和易于理解。
-
数据可视化:图形化编程工具可以用于创建数据可视化的图表和图形。用户可以使用图形化界面来选择数据源、定义图形类型和样式,以及添加交互性和动画效果。这使得数据分析和呈现更加易于操作和理解。
-
物联网(IoT)应用:图形化编程工具可以用于编写物联网设备的控制程序。用户可以使用图形化界面来设计设备之间的通信和交互,以及定义设备的行为和响应。这种方法使物联网应用的开发更加简单和快速。
-
教育和学习:图形化编程工具可以用于教育和学习编程。它们提供了一种直观和可视化的方式来引导学生学习编程概念和逻辑思维。学生可以通过拖放代码块来构建程序,而不需要手动编写代码。
无论是在游戏开发、机器人编程、数据可视化、物联网应用还是教育领域,图形化编程都提供了一种简单、直观和易于理解的编程方式,使得编程变得更加有趣和可行。
1年前 -